    July 27, 2025 at 1:57 am in reply to: Cheat Meal

    Super person dependent.
    If they look like they need to be fresher in a prep I will drop cardio and refeed.

    The amount is based on what their current intake is, how flat they are, how fast they usually burn through a high day or vise versa hold from, what the timeline is, etc.

    It’s trial and error, try something and see how you respond, and then base any changes for next time off of that.

    July 22, 2025 at 10:45 pm in reply to: Rear delt

    Think of Swinging “out” and not “back”
    Don’t use momentum
    Don’t shrug the weight
    Find the connection with the rear delt and move in the path that keeps it

    July 20, 2025 at 2:45 pm in reply to: Early hours lifting

    Treat it like any other time of day and don’t think your performance or nutrition needs to be any different just because of the time.

    Get to bed at a sensible hour, wake up and eat and go to the gym and have intra training supplementation.
    If you absolutely cannot eat then do powders

    July 16, 2025 at 12:26 pm in reply to: Tracking direct macros

    Consistency is most important.

    I am consistent with all the sources I use daily so therefor my protein requirement is met with direct protein sources, and indirect sources are in addition to that. For example if I sub bread for rice I do not adjust the protein
